First stone shipped not opal, waiting to hear from seller for new genuine opal
Ethiopian opal is hyrdrophane opal. It soak up water like a sponge. Lick your finger and press it to the stone and the opal will stick to your finger.This piece shipped did not do that at all, had no color in it, was smaller than advertised on Amazon. It was a piece of underdeveloped opal that looked like frozen peanut butter.I work with opal and if this piece would be one that I would cut off of an opal and throw out!Returned for a replacement......waiting to see if seller actually has any opal like pictured and closer to size advertised. The piece sent was not 27.55 cts. but barely 21 cts.Will update when or if new piece arrives.
